Joe's Journey Late 1960s

A seven-year-old catches the bug

Sitting in on drums with the bands at his father's restaurant, the Capri 400, in Port Ewen, NY. Too young to know it yet, but the hospitality business and the music business are about to shape everything that follows.

1975

The fire that forged everything

House fire destroys the family home. Thirteen years old, living in motel rooms for months. Learns the lesson that stays forever: the things that actually matter can't burn.

1980

SUNY Fredonia

Auditions as a vocal major because he's unprepared for percussion. Creates his own degree: B.S. in Special Studies. Jazz Ensemble wins at Notre Dame. Chamber Singers tour Europe. Four years of figuring it out on the fly.

1984

New York City

Moves to Queens with nothing. Survives on hot dogs and ramen. Sits in at the Blue Note, 55 Bar, Sweet Basil, Village Vanguard. Ted Curson becomes a mentor. Plays CBGB's. The jazz circuit becomes the real education.

1990

The road years

Twelve years with Paul Mark & The Van Dorens. Recording at legendary studios with Stevie Ray Vaughan's producer. Blues festivals alongside James Cotton and Kim Wilson. A decade of preparation disguised as a music career.

2002

The pivot to Arizona

Leaves New York behind. Starts an ACT! consultancy, then HomeLogics in Scottsdale. The music never stops, but the business instincts are sharpening. Everything is converging toward something he can't see yet.

2011

The moment everything changed

An audition in LA that doesn't go as planned. A residency at the Montelucia Resort that does. JC Productions is born. Not as a booking agency. As a different answer to a question nobody else was asking.

2013

Onstage is born

JC Productions becomes Onstage Entertainment Group. The DMC market opens up. The insight lands: become the one-stop solution nobody else is offering. The platform starts to take shape.

2019

126 meetings in 42 days

Colorado expansion roadshow. Six months later, a global pandemic makes it all disappear. The test of whether a business built on relationships can survive when every event in the world gets cancelled.

Today

1,200+ performers. 50 states. One standard.

Thirty years of preparation built something nobody planned for. A nationwide entertainment agency run by a team that understands both sides of the stage, because the founder spent decades on both.
